Contractors, freelancers, and consultants are self-employed individuals who work alone or as part of other businesses. These terms cause a great deal of confusion because they are often used interchangeably when discussing self-employment.

A consultant is someone who acts as an individual or through a service company and provides services to your business on a self-employed basis. A consultant is not your employee and therefore does not have an Employment contract.

The law does not require you to complete a contract with your self-employed or freelance workers - a verbal contract can exist even when there is nothing in writing.

Freelancers and consultants are known as "independent contractors" in legal terms. An independent contractor (IC) is a person who contracts to perform services for others without having the legal status of an employee.

IR35 provides that anyone using a limited company intermediary for his contract work, (we will call him or her a consultant from now), who fails the "self-employed" test is now deemed to be in "disguised employment" and will no longer be able to take advantage of the tax regime available to a business.

Consultants. Consultants provide services to a company, but don't work directly for it. In most cases, consultants are either part of a consulting firm or are their own incorporated businesses. Employers pay the consulting business, not the individual consultant.

While full-time employees can be moved to a variety of projects once hired, consultants are typically project-specific. Contractors generally collect on a larger paycheck. Due to the jobs being temporary and therefore less secure, consultants are typically paid above market rates.
